We are thrilled to announce that The Queen's inverted coming of age tale, Fifteen, has been accepted into the prestigious Oscar qualifying Raindance Film Festival. Written and produced by Corin West this wonderful short examines innocence, mistakes and their consequences.
The Queen (Dan Lumb and Crinan Campbell) are no strangers to the short film awards circuit, having won the first ever London Sundance short film competition for their short Extranjero in 2012.
